Hurst Autoplex Connect is a dealer-branded vehicle management app for iOS that provides owners with battery monitoring, location tracking, and service reminders.

The App DNA

What makes this app unique?

Dealerships hire the app to maintain brand presence on the user's home screen and automate service-bay return visits via real-time vehicle data.

For Automotive dealership owners, GMs, and service directors seeking to increase customer retention and service department revenue.

How much does it cost?

freeFree app for consumers provided as part of the dealership relationship

The consumer app is a free utility component of a B2B SaaS model where the dealership pays for the underlying telematics and marketing platform.

How's the Productivity market?

The app occupies a niche B2B-to-C space, acting as a dealer-branded utility rather than a standalone consumer product. Its lack of remote vehicle commands relative to OEM apps like Kia Access signals a focus on service-retention mechanics over lifestyle-feature parity.

Where is it heading?

The market for dealer-branded telematics is consolidating around high-utility remote commands, forcing apps like Hurst Autoplex Connect to either match OEM feature sets or risk becoming obsolete. The current maintenance-focused release cadence suggests a defensive posture that will struggle to retain users as OEM apps continue to integrate deeper vehicle control.

  • Recent updates focused on map-pin persistence and timeout durations, indicating a maintenance-heavy release cycle rather than aggressive feature expansion.
  • The absence of remote vehicle commands in the latest release leaves the app vulnerable to feature-parity erosion by OEM competitors.
